10 Tips To Protect Your Business From an HR Nightmare

Business Owners are too often either over or under sold on the basics of what they need to run their business. From registering an LLC to financials, insurance, employees, a place to actually run the business, there's a lot that goes into getting things off the ground and rarely is the business owner an expert at all of those areas. 

The Chamber hosted a Pro-Tips: What’s the Risk? event that was able to provide legal liability and important insurance options that all businesses should be aware of. The main goal was to inform business owners how to protect what they’ve worked so hard to build and to make sure they are appropriately covered for their type of business. 
 
Susie Cirilli, an attorney with Litchfield Cavo, brought her legal expertise on labor employment law to the table to inform the audience about worker’s compensation, sexual harassment, and different kinds of discrimination laws. Bill Sprague, the owner of Risk Averse Insurance, brought his knowledge of insurance to better explain the different types of insurance policies to protect your business. He went over various policies that aren’t covered by a general liability policy such as: auto policies, business interruption, EPLI, and professional liability. Bill explained how the worker’s compensation time line works and how to handle worker’s compensation. 
​
Here's 10 things to take away from this event:
  1. Worker’s Compensation is the law and it’s there to help you.
  2. Document everything. It will help you if an employee sues for discrimination before, during, or after they are hired/terminated.
  3. Always submit a Worker’s Compensation claim immediately. You have 21 days to submit the claim if someone is injured.
  4. Create a company handbook and have a mission statement to outline the company’s values and policies. It will help you make difficult business decisions
  5. 40% of businesses can expect at least one claim in a 10-year period.
  6. When hiring, ignore things such as name, race, gender, and interests to prevent any personal biases. Hire employees based on their qualifications.
  7. Know your rates and language of your policies. Don’t be surprised by audits.
  8. Sexual harassment claims have risen by 12% in this past year.
  9. Review and Renew your contracts and handbooks at the end of each cycle.
  10. Be careful during holiday parties or any event where alcohol is included. You can still be liable if anything happens.
